Shanghai's long-established bicycle brand Phoenix has opened its first brick-and-mortar flagship store for its premium sub-brand Fnix.

Located in Livat Shanghai shopping center, Fnix Space showcases the brand's complete lineup of road bikes, mountain bikes, electric touring bikes, and more.

In recent years, e-bikes have surged in popularity overseas, and Phoenix's lithium-powered models have performed strongly in international markets. At Fnix Space, visitors can see the China-market debut of the "Time" (Chinese: 时光) electric touring bike, which launched earlier this year.

The model features a sleek, minimalist design available in deep black, glossy gray, and latte coffee. Its motor, developed over seven years of research, delivers precise, responsive pedal assistance. Riders can choose from five levels of electric support, with a range of 150-180 kilometers at the lowest level and about 70 km at the highest.

Fnix has steadily strengthened its presence in professional cycling through team sponsorship, race naming rights, and city cycling events. Inside Fnix Space, visitors can view championship-winning bikes ridden by Fnix-sponsored continental teams, now also available for purchase.

In 2024, Phoenix sponsored the Tour of Shanghai and supplied Fnix race bikes for the competition. This year, the brand deepened its involvement by partnering with the Chinese professional road cycling team Hengxiang, establishing the Fnix-SCOM-Hengxiang Cycling Team. Team riders compete on Fnix road bikes in events such as the Tour of Thailand and Tour of Hainan, delivering notable performances.

As cycling continues to evolve from a mode of transport into a lifestyle and cultural pursuit, Fnix Space integrates diverse experiences to engage visitors. The store features smart cycling trainers that replicate professional training conditions, provide real-time performance data, and allow users to join virtual competitions remotely.
